Transaction 84623055a86af12fed035030489f4af6a55fc788f69ba272bf4cb318ade0bf34
1 Input
1 Output
-
84623055a86af12fed035030489f4af6a55fc788f69ba272bf4cb318ade0bf34:0
- value
- 53642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b40a8feb2b942ad50f4750129c0040484ab66f3 OP_EQUAL
- address
- 3LDiZ9g61nLYDE8xdu481ndRfxWUmxpr5G